You’re building around annual community event. The loose, decentralized annual celebration of podcasting on September 30. Started in 2014 by Steve Lee.

Pick Podnews if

You’re building around industry news. If you only read one podcast newsletter, this is it. James Cridland's daily dispatch is short, dense, and global — heavy on platform moves, hires, and tech changes.
